おのたく日記 YouTubeも始めました→
2004-08-20(Fri) [長年日記]
■ [J2EE] メッセージを理解する: J2EE 1.4のメッセージング
J2EE 1.3でのJMS 1.0と、J2EE 1.4のJMS 1.1の違いの解説。
J2EE 1.4では、JMSで一つのConnectionに、一つのSessionという制限がついたけど、
Java Connector Architecture (JCA)仕様の最新版は、JMSプロバイダーがJCAリソース・アダプターとしてインプリメントされる事を提案します。JMSにはオブジェクトが3つ(ConnectionFactory、Connection、そしてSession)あるのに対し、JCAプログラミング・モデルでは、(JDBCと同様に)オブジェクトは2つ(ConnectionFactory と Connection)しかありません。さらに重要な事として、JCAではConnection (JMSではSession)がトランザクションに関連する事です。したがって、JMSで1つ以上のSessionをConnection毎に許可した場合、Connection は事実上1つ以上のトランザクションと関連します
[メッセージを理解する: J2EE 1.4のメッセージングより引用]
だそうな。なるほど!
送り手と受けてをresource-env-refで一つにつなげるのは面倒だったけど、「2つのmessage-destination-refを同一のmessage-destinationにリンクする」事が出来るのは、分かりやすくて良いね。
この記事での紹介されていた。「JMS 1.1のドメイン統合によるメッセージングの簡素化」は、J2EE 1.3のときのJMSでQueueとTopicの二つがあって面倒だったのが、統一されたという話で、分かりやすくてよい。
JMS 1.0.2の時には、結局、Queueしか使っていなかったものねー
■ [News] 役員の給与は従業員の2倍前後
「大企業の役員平均年収は1800万円弱」って事は、ベンチャーやっていた方が、お金の入りはいいのね〜 たなーか君が、年収二千万は軽いって言ってたし。
|